From: Richard M. Stallman Date: Wed, 18 May 1994 23:37:55 +0000 (+0000) Subject: (Fset_window_buffer): Fix dedicated window error call. X-Git-Tag: emacs-19.34~8308 X-Git-Url: http://git.eshelyaron.com/gitweb/?a=commitdiff_plain;h=3cf855321c7d3a36aa2f292868dff65dc19becf6;p=emacs.git (Fset_window_buffer): Fix dedicated window error call. (window_loop, case UNSHOW_BUFFER): Clear dedicated flag. --- diff --git a/src/window.c b/src/window.c index ce0b05339ee..8fa6472057a 100644 --- a/src/window.c +++ b/src/window.c @@ -1269,6 +1269,7 @@ window_loop (type, obj, mini, frames) if (NILP (another_buffer)) another_buffer = Fget_buffer_create (build_string ("*scratch*")); + XWINDOW (w)->dedicated = Qnil; Fset_window_buffer (w, another_buffer); if (EQ (w, selected_window)) Fset_buffer (XWINDOW (w)->buffer); @@ -1626,7 +1627,8 @@ BUFFER can be a buffer or buffer name.") is first being set up. */ { if (!NILP (w->dedicated) && !EQ (tem, buffer)) - error ("Window is dedicated to %s\n", tem); + error ("Window is dedicated to `%s'", + XSTRING (XBUFFER (tem)->name)->data); unshow_buffer (w); }